								SYSFS FILES
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  For each InfiniBand device, the InfiniBand drivers create the
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  following files under /sys/class/infiniband/<device name>:
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    node_type      - Node type (CA, switch or router)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    node_guid      - Node GUID
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    sys_image_guid - System image GUID
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  In addition, there is a "ports" subdirectory, with one subdirectory
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  for each port.  For example, if mthca0 is a 2-port HCA, there will
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  be two directories:
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    /sys/class/infiniband/mthca0/ports/1
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    /sys/class/infiniband/mthca0/ports/2
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  (A switch will only have a single "0" subdirectory for switch port
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  0; no subdirectory is created for normal switch ports)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  In each port subdirectory, the following files are created:
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    cap_mask       - Port capability mask
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    lid            - Port LID
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    lid_mask_count - Port LID mask count
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    rate           - Port data rate (active width * active speed)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    sm_lid         - Subnet manager LID for port's subnet
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    sm_sl          - Subnet manager SL for port's subnet
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    state          - Port state (DOWN, INIT, ARMED, ACTIVE or ACTIVE_DEFER)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    phys_state     - Port physical state (Sleep, Polling, LinkUp, etc)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  There is also a "counters" subdirectory, with files
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    VL15_dropped
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    excessive_buffer_overrun_errors
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    link_downed
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    link_error_recovery
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    local_link_integrity_errors
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_rcv_constraint_errors
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_rcv_data
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_rcv_errors
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_rcv_packets
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_rcv_remote_physical_errors
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_rcv_switch_relay_errors
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_xmit_constraint_errors
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_xmit_data
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_xmit_discards
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    port_xmit_packets
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    symbol_error
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  Each of these files contains the corresponding value from the port's
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  Performance Management PortCounters attribute, as described in
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  section 16.1.3.5 of the InfiniBand Architecture Specification.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  The "pkeys" and "gids" subdirectories contain one file for each
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  entry in the port's P_Key or GID table respectively.  For example,
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  ports/1/pkeys/10 contains the value at index 10 in port 1's P_Key
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  table.

								MTHCA
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								  The Mellanox HCA driver also creates the files:
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    hw_rev   - Hardware revision number
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    fw_ver   - Firmware version
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    hca_type - HCA type: "MT23108", "MT25208 (MT23108 compat mode)",
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								               or "MT25208"
